Screen Script Reading Video Procedure

Use this procedure to create screen script reading video.

  1. Copy existing screen reading base video for other project or create new project in wondershare filmora with following settings.
    •  Aspect Ratio : 1:1 Instagram.
    • Resolution : 600 by 600.
    • Frame Rate : 24 FPS.
    • SDR REc 709.
    • Audio: 44100 Hz.
  2. Import bookshelf background and set as background video. Lock its layer to avoid cutting during future operations.
  3. Save project as projectinitial_Screen_Script_Reading_Video_Language. May have already done this if copied from existing project.
  4. Import screen reading mobile video.
  5. Import mp3 file.
  6. Select video and audio file and to auto alignment.
  7. Mute audio included in video file.
  8. Cut initial unwanted portion of audio and video.
  9. Scale video to 180% or other percentage as seem good, both in X and Y axis.
  10. Center head on frame horizontally using X position.
  11. In color option of video, set brightness to 10, highlight and shadow both to 36.
  12. In AI Tools, do AI Protrait Cutout to remove background of the video. It will take quite some time. Do some physical work.
  13. Process audio file as follows:
    • Activate Auto Normalisation.
    • Set Equalizer to Hard Rock.
    • Activate Voice Enhancer.
    • Activate AI Denoising and wait for it to complete.
  14. Activate Auto Ripple in top left corner of timelines section.
  15. Cut remove all errors in talking from both video and audio.
  16. Select all video clips by zooming and selecting, then right click on dissolve 3 transition and press apply. Delete last transition if any.
  17. Play and listen to entire video once. Check if any errors.
  18. Export video. Use following settings.
    • Folder : Clips folder for the video.
    • File Name : Same as project name.
    • Format : MP4
    • Resolution : 600 X 600
    • Encoder : H.264
    • Quality : High
  19. Export Audio in mp3 format and send to whatsapp personal account for playing during screen recording as well as to match separate screen recording videos with audio.
